More intense Indian summer monsoons

Satellite data from 1991 to 2020 show heavier summer rainfall that is likely to continue
  • Sept. 18, 2024

    A recent case study written in collaboration with EUMETSAT’s Dr Rob Roebeling shows how satellite observations confirm changes in Indian summer monsoons.

    Figure 1: Pre-summer monsoon trends for the month of May in precipitation (left panel), soil moisture (middle left panel), normalized difference vegetation index (middle right panel), and surface temperature (right panel) over the period 2008–2020. The data to produce these images were taken from the in-situ data provided by the Indian Meteorological Department (IMD), the scatterometer surface soil moisture dataset of the Hydrology Satellite Application Facility (H SAF), the Normalized Difference Vegetation Index (NDVI) dataset of the Land Surface Analysis Satellite Application Facility (LSA SAF), and the temperature dataset of the ECMWF's fifth ECMWF reanalysis (ERA-5) (source: EUMETSAT)
